I do understand your emphatic stance, but I disagree with your choice of comparisons. You tend to confuse charity & business(money), no offense.

You probably have no idea the kind of over-head cost required to run these big malls & supermarkets. From power (diesel & generator maintenance) cost, staff remuneration, utility cost, security, rent etc These are all cash intensive ventures that is not helped by the ever present unfavourable business environment faced in the country. These superstores have their own challenges like the popular pidgin English proverbs goes "big man, big wahala". Let's not forget these big stores usually use standardized prices.

Imagine a situation whereby everybody that patronized a gala/go slow snack seller, kiosk owner, market stall seller etc paid without the usual haggling of price then we'll have an inflation crises in our hands that will make that of Zimbabwe look like child's play.

BTW who says you can't tip a road-side seller for impressive service received? At least then the seller is able to distinguish a tip from actual cost of the product.
